Transaction 2641b3e2425382006dedd1c9eddd94882dbe51ffb39f8733eb6a1f42928971f9

1 Input
2 Outputs
  • 2641b3e2425382006dedd1c9eddd94882dbe51ffb39f8733eb6a1f42928971f9:0
  • value  53144597
    address  1FcyxMo9CmC4P7sCmGdw6YCT71MbrzJWm1
  • 2641b3e2425382006dedd1c9eddd94882dbe51ffb39f8733eb6a1f42928971f9:1
  • value  21725500
    address  1ahqjeh5Ayvuidiw9ekRizjA2CeWRHMrf